Why does multiplying two fractional Doubles and converting the result to a String result in extraneous zeroes?

后端 未结 0 882
死守一世寂寞
死守一世寂寞 2020-12-31 12:15
var d1 = 0.124 * 0.12456 // 0.01544544
var s1 = String(d1)      // 0.015445440000000001

var d2 = 0.01544544      // 0.01544544
var s2 = String(d2)      // 0.0154454         


        
相关标签:
回答
  • 消灭零回复
提交回复
热议问题